About this course

This course focuses on the unique challenges and opportunities of purchasing negotiation, providing learners with the tools and techniques to drive better deals, reduce costs, and improve supplier relationships. By enrolling in this course, learners will gain a deep understanding of the negotiation process, from preparation and planning to execution and follow-up. They will develop a range of essential skills, including communication, persuasion, conflict resolution, and strategic thinking. With a strong emphasis on practical application, this course is highly relevant to professionals in a variety of industries, including procurement, supply chain management, sales, and marketing. By completing this course, learners will be equipped with the skills and knowledge necessary to advance their careers, increase their earning potential, and make a positive impact on their organizations.

Course Details

• Understanding Purchasing Negotiations: An Overview
• The Role of Procurement in Business Success
• Preparing for Successful Negotiations: Research and Planning
• Key Elements of Effective Purchasing Negotiations
• Leveraging Data and Analytics in Purchasing Negotiations
• Building Strong Relationships for Successful Negotiations
• Communication Strategies for Effective Purchasing Negotiations
• Overcoming Common Negotiation Challenges
• Negotiation Ethics and Compliance
• Continuous Improvement in Purchasing Negotiations
